function loginbutton() {
	var str=document.Notes.httpWebFolder.value;
	var pos=str.indexOf("/");
	if (pos>=0){
		str = str.substring(pos+2, str.length);
		pos=str.indexOf("/");
		str = str.substring(0, pos);
	}
	else{
		alert(' / was not found in httpWebFolder, please check your System Keyword')
	}
	var redirectTo = document.Notes.ProtocolSetting.value + str + "/names.nsf?login&username="+document.Login.username.value +"&password="+ document.Login.password.value +"&redirectto="+ document.Notes.ProtocolSetting.value + str + document.Notes.LoginRedirectURL.value;
	top.location.href=redirectTo;
 }
function logoutbutton() {
	var str=document.Notes.httpWebFolder.value;
	var pos=str.indexOf("/");
	if (pos>=0){
		str = str.substring(pos+2, str.length);
		pos=str.indexOf("/");
		str = str.substring(0, pos);
	}
	else{
		alert(' / was not found in httpWebFolder, please check your System Keyword')
	}
	top.location.href=document.Notes.httpWebpath.value + "?logout&redirectto=" + document.Notes.ProtocolSetting.value + str + document.Notes.LogoutRedirectURL.value;
}
function enteredPassword(event) {
	if (navigator.appName.indexOf('Microsoft') >= 0) {
		if (window.event && window.event.keyCode == 13)
			loginbutton();
		else
			return true;
	} else if (event && event.which == 13) {
		loginbutton();
	} else {
		return true;
	}
}
